Transaction 8862da6333141588708f3e9fe5aff9652df83bd8b8d20716bae2c6e3352aa14f
1 Input
1 Output
-
8862da6333141588708f3e9fe5aff9652df83bd8b8d20716bae2c6e3352aa14f:0
- value
- 1346065
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46cf116abe1e7d375493efc655f10bcf37c9448b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17TQMmWddb9F4YmSonLn6nFxtrsygpfz6L